Cottage Cheese Pizza Bowl Recipe
Introduction
This Cottage Cheese Pizza Bowl offers a creamy, satisfying twist on traditional pizza. Combining cottage cheese, zesty marinara, fresh veggies, and melted mozzarella, it’s a simple and delicious meal perfect for a cozy night in.

Ingredients
- 1 cup cottage cheese (low-fat or full-fat as per preference)
- 1 cup marinara sauce (store-bought or homemade)
- 1/2 cup chopped bell peppers (any color)
- 1/2 cup sliced mushrooms
- 1/2 cup chopped spinach or kale
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- Olive oil, salt, and pepper to taste
- Optional toppings: sliced olives, diced onions, fresh basil
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to prepare for baking.
- Step 2: In a medium baking dish, spread the cottage cheese evenly across the bottom to create a creamy base.
- Step 3: Spoon the marinara sauce generously over the cottage cheese layer.
- Step 4: Scatter the chopped bell peppers, mushrooms, and spinach evenly over the sauce.
- Step 5: Top everything with shredded mozzarella cheese and any optional toppings you prefer.
- Step 6: Drizzle with olive oil, then season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Step 7: Bake in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Step 8: Remove from the oven, let cool slightly, and serve hot. Garnish with fresh basil if desired.
Tips & Variations
- Mix different cheeses like ricotta or parmesan with the mozzarella for added creaminess and flavor.
- Try swapping or adding veggies such as zucchini, broccoli, or artichokes for variety.
- Keep an eye on the baking time to prevent the cheese from browning too much.
- For extra creaminess, mix the cottage cheese with marinara sauce before layering.
Storage
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the microwave or bake at 350°F (175°C) for 10-15 minutes until warmed through. You can also freeze portions for later use—make sure to cool completely before freezing in a suitable container.

FAQs
Can I use other types of cheese instead of mozzarella?
Yes, you can substitute or combine mozzarella with cheeses like ricotta for creaminess or parmesan for a sharper flavor.
Is it necessary to bake the bowl, or can it be served cold?
Baking melts the cheese and blends the flavors, creating a warm, comforting dish. While you can eat it cold, baking is recommended for the best taste and texture.
